      I use sketchup in interior design and spend most of the time building kitchens, work is a daily procedure which I hardly change lately, but I spend that much time importing and looking trough libraries to get the components...

      I decided to get into DC's so that I'll work on that one dynamic component until it fills my needs...

      I'd need some expert advice though, the 'children' that I resize get their position scaled too, and I could not figure out how to keep them in the exact XYZ...

      any help ?

      I'll attach the DC, I know whoever is gonna help is going to ask that

        Hi Gert-Jan

        My method is to place the groups in the desired locations, then right click each one and change the axis so that I can locate a common point. Then figure out the formulas, copy the common ones through.

        I updated your component to suit, also added variables to cover the width and height without directly exposing lenY, lenZ this avoids the blanks between option changes.
